Recognizing Low-VOC Paints
When you pick low-VOC paints, you're going with a product that produces fewer unpredictable natural substances, which can be unsafe to both your wellness and the setting.
VOCs are chemicals found in lots of paint products that can evaporate into the air and contribute to interior air pollution. By choosing low-VOC alternatives, you're lowering the variety of these exhausts, making your space much safer.
Low-VOC paints usually contain 50 grams per litre or less VOCs, compared to typical paints that can consist of approximately 250 grams per litre. This suggests that when you paint your home with low-VOC items, you're not simply deciding for aesthetics; you're likewise taking an action towards a healthier indoor atmosphere.
